Output 83fa69d947b95469c51fcbca5b4f1540c18f3395c4af03ad7120dfb0377d4141:0

value
636808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f9bd4a4e5f590e75e75c6d22cf7a1b5c7bc48e OP_EQUAL
address
3FYb8i52fmGyFj3mW4wphiSQSHJt8mqNca
transaction
83fa69d947b95469c51fcbca5b4f1540c18f3395c4af03ad7120dfb0377d4141
spent
true